Dashboard — Plastic Work Cockpit
A deterministic overview of the intent store(s). It answers three questions at a glance: where we are (recently worked), where we go next (the most-valuable next work), and how to conduct it (a disposition per intent). The human-facing surface is Markdown, because the user's UI renders Markdown natively but collapses raw tool-call stdout.
The script does all the data work. The agent fills a Markdown template from the script's payload with near-zero reasoning and presents the filled board in its reply. Same store state → byte-identical payload, regardless of model. Do NOT hand-summarize intents.

Procedure (the Markdown board — default human surface)
Step 1 — Get the data payload
ruby ~/.plastic/scripts/dashboard.rb [continue|project <slug>] --data
continue(default) → the global board payload (mode: "global").project <slug>→ that project board payload (mode: "project").
The payload is read-only JSON. Global-board fields: date, store_health, summary,
next_work, next_total, next_shown, counts, projects, project_totals, footer.
Project-board fields: slug, store_health, description, summary, counts, active,
active_total, active_shown, next_work, next_total, next_shown, footer. summary
and footer are finished prose strings (2-3 sentences and one line respectively), built in
dashboard.rb and substituted verbatim, exactly like {{date}}/{{description}} already
are - never re-worded or re-derived by the skill. Each list carries cell-ready fields for
its table: next_work rows are
{id, intent, scope, lifecycle, value, disposition, flags, what, flags_label, line};
active rows carry
{id, intent, created, bullet, scope, what, stage, worker, activity, line}. The what,
scope, worker, activity, and flags_label cell fields arrive pipe-escaped and
whitespace-normalized.
